Key Responsibilities
Cloud Architecture: Design, implement, and optimize secure, scalable, and cost-efficient cloud infrastructure leveraging AWS core services (VPC, EC2, Lambda, IAM, S3, ECS/EKS, etc.).
CI/CD Leadership: Architect and manage enterprise-grade CI/CD pipelines using Jenkins, integrating static code analysis, unit testing, and automated deployments.
Infrastructure Automation: Develop modular Terraform configurations and reusable automation patterns to enable rapid environment provisioning and consistency.
DevSecOps Governance: Enforce compliance and security best practices across build and deployment pipelines, integrating secrets management, policy-as-code, and role-based access controls.
Monitoring & Observability: Implement advanced monitoring frameworks using Prometheus, Grafana, CloudWatch, and ELK stack to maintain system reliability and performance visibility.
Mentorship & Collaboration: Serve as a trusted technical advisor and mentor to engineers, fostering collaboration and continuous improvement across teams.
Incident Response & Root Cause Analysis: Lead the troubleshooting of complex CI/CD or cloud infrastructure issues, performing postmortems and identifying process improvements.
